Limestone filler : GCCA

In cement manufacture, the addition of limestone reduces costs (limestone being a cheaper material than clinker), while its good grindability allows producers to easily increase production capacity without detrimental impact on existing equipment or costly investment in new equipment.

Cement Industry: Limestone and future outlook

The limestone requirement is proportionate to the estimated cement production as according to the general rule of thumb each tonne of cement requires approximately 1.1 tonnes of cement grade limestone.

Chapter 21 Lime, Portland Cement, and Concrete Flashcards

-The manufacture of Portland cement begins with quarrying limestone, which is later crushed to approximately 5/8 -in.-size particles-Crushed limestone and other raw materials (clay, sand, and iron ore) are stored in silos for processing as needed-The raw materials are mixed together in required proportions and ground to a fine powder in a grinding mill.

Cement and Concrete Sustainability

Portland-limestone cement (PLC) is relatively new to the US, but has been used internationally for many decades in all aspects of concrete construction. PLC is a blended cement that incorporates between 5% and 15% limestone as an ingredient, which lowers its environmental footprint by about 10%.

Concrete | MIT Climate Portal

Concrete: its ingredients and impacts. Concrete is a mix of several different materials: water, fine aggregates (or sand), coarse aggregates (or gravel), chemical additives, and, most importantly, cement. Cement is what binds all of these ingredients together to give concrete its durability and distinctive, grey appearance.

Portland-Limestone Cement

Crushed limestone is often the main raw ingredient in the manufacture of portland cement clinker that eventually becomes cement. Other raw material sources of calcium carbonate include shells, chalk or marl, which are combined with shale, clay, slate, blast furnace slag, silica sand or iron ore.
